Alice Watson
Alice P. Watson age 100 of York, NE died Monday, July 17, 2006 at York. She was born September 5, 1905 on a farm northwest of York to Elmer and Mary (Shapland) Jenkins. She attended country school and graduated from York High School. She also graduated from the York College Academy and then taught country school for 5 years. Alice was married to Earl W. Watson on May 19, 1929 in York. They lived on the farm until retirement in 1974. Alice was a member of the Shiloh Country Church and later a member of the East Avenue United Methodist Church in York. She was an active member of the United Methodist Women and the Garden Club. She also volunteered at York General Hospital and helped with Meals on Wheels. Alice enjoyed gardening and spending time with her family.
